About This Book

The book offers illustrated, chronological portraits of late medieval and early Renaissance royal courts, focusing on successive queens and their households, marriages, political roles, and social surroundings. Drawing from chronicles, letters, and earlier histories, it interweaves biographical sketches with accounts of ceremonies, fashions, family alliances, and key political events, supplemented by genealogies, maps, and period illustrations that illuminate courtly customs, architecture, and daily life.

About the Author

Bearne, Mrs. portrait

Mrs. Bearne

Mrs. Bearne was a writer known for her insightful explorations of French society during pivotal historical periods. Her notable works include "Heroines of French Society / in the Court, the Revolution, the Empire and the Restoration," which delves into the lives of influential women in France, and "Pictures of the Old French Court," offering a vivid portrayal of court life. Through her writings, she contributed to the understanding of the cultural and social dynamics of her time, reflecting on the roles women played in shaping history.
